Climate Risk Profile: Tullamore, NSW
Tullamore is a rural town in NSW facing increasing risks from flooding and heatwaves due to climate change. Bushfire risk is also a concern. Residents should prepare for more frequent extreme weather events.

Learn moreAbout Tullamore's Climate Risk Profile
Tullamore, located in the central west region of New South Wales, is a community that will likely experience the effects of climate change in the coming decades. The primary concerns for Tullamore are increased flooding risk due to more intense rainfall events, and more frequent and severe heatwaves.
The risk of flooding is driven by the local topography and the potential for heavy rainfall events to overwhelm existing drainage infrastructure. Climate projections suggest that rainfall intensity will increase, leading to a higher likelihood of flash flooding and riverine flooding.
Heatwaves are another significant concern for Tullamore. As average temperatures rise, the frequency and intensity of heatwaves are expected to increase, posing a risk to vulnerable populations, particularly the elderly and those with pre-existing health conditions.
While Tullamore is not directly exposed to coastal risks, the broader impacts of climate change, such as disruptions to agricultural production and supply chains, could indirectly affect the community. Residents should take proactive steps to prepare for these challenges.

Frequently Asked Questions
What are the main climate change risks for Tullamore?
The main risks are increased flooding due to more intense rainfall, more frequent and severe heatwaves, and a higher risk of bushfires.
How can I prepare my home for flooding?
Ensure your property has adequate drainage, elevate valuable items, and consider flood-proofing measures.
What should I do during a heatwave?
Stay hydrated, seek air-conditioned environments, and check on vulnerable neighbors.
How can I protect my property from bushfires?
Clear vegetation around your home, have a bushfire survival plan, and monitor fire danger ratings.
